Pinteristing
《Pinteresting:初探JavaScript实现的移动应用》 在当今的互联网世界中,JavaScript以其强大的功能和灵活性,成为构建Web应用的首选语言。而当我们谈论到“Pinteresting”这个项目时,我们可以理解它是一个由JavaScript驱动的、简易版的移动应用程序。这是一款初学者的实践作品,旨在展示如何利用JavaScript技术来创建一个类似于Pinterest的平台。 在“Pinteresting”中,开发者可能运用了JavaScript的基础语法,包括变量声明(var、let、const)、数据类型(字符串、数字、对象等)、控制流(条件语句if...else、switch、循环for、while)以及函数的定义和调用,这些都是JavaScript编程的核心元素。此外,为了实现动态交互,可能还涉及到事件监听和处理,比如点击事件、滚动事件等,这些是网页与用户交互的关键。 JavaScript在前端开发中的另一个重要角色是DOM(Document Object Model)操作。在这个项目中,开发者可能通过JavaScript来选择、修改或添加DOM元素,实现页面动态更新。例如,当用户浏览或搜索内容时,JavaScript可以用来动态加载新的图片或信息,提供流畅的用户体验。 考虑到这是一个移动端的应用,开发者可能使用了响应式设计,确保“Pinteresting”在不同设备和屏幕尺寸上都能良好运行。这可能涉及CSS媒体查询(Media Queries)和Flexbox或Grid布局技术,以适应不同的屏幕大小和方向。 另外,JavaScript库和框架对于简化开发和提升性能至关重要。“Pinteresting”项目中没有明确提及使用了哪些特定的库或框架,但考虑到其简洁性,开发者可能选择了轻量级的解决方案,如jQuery用于简化DOM操作,或者Vue.js或React.js这样的现代框架来处理组件化和状态管理。 文件名“Pinteresting-master”暗示了项目采用的是Git进行版本控制,"master"分支通常是开发的主要分支,这意味着开发者可能遵循了良好的版本控制实践,定期提交代码并维护代码历史。 “Pinteresting”项目为初学者提供了一个了解JavaScript在移动应用开发中实际应用的实例。通过这个项目,学习者可以掌握如何利用JavaScript创建交互式的前端应用,并了解到前端开发的基本流程和技术栈。同时,这也展示了将个人技能应用于实际项目中的可能性,是提升编程能力的重要步骤。
- 1
- 2
- 粉丝: 27
- 资源: 4783
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- java版KTV预定管理系统源码数据库 MySQL源码类型 WebForm
- 农业收成-java-基于SpringBoot的农业收成管理系统设计与实现
- 电缆行业生产-java-基于springBoot的电缆行业生产管理系统设计与实现
- 仿照顺丰速运的一个小项目-华清速递
- (源码)基于Arduino的智能花园灌溉系统.zip
- 商城积分-java-基于springBoot的商城积分系统设计与实现
- 个性化智能学习-java-基于springBoot个性化智能学习系统设计与实现
- 英语学习-java-基于springBoot英语学习平台设计与实现
- 数字资源共享-java-基于springBoot数字资源共享平台设计与实现
- (源码)基于Qt框架的翻金币游戏系统.zip